Let’s embark on a culinary journey with our Grilled Caesar Salad, featuring a homemade Caesar dressing. Infused with the bold flavors of minced anchovy fillets, garlic, Dijon mustard, freshly squeezed l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, mayonnaise, and a zesty kick from prepared horseradish, the dressing is the heart of our Cesar salad. It elevates each bite with its creamy texture and harmonious blend of savory and tangy notes. To craft this exquisite dressing, we begin by combining the minced anchovy fillets, garlic,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, mayonnaise, prepared horseradish, and ground black pepper in a mixing bowl. Whisk together until the ingredients meld into a creamy symphony, and then slowly drizzle in extra virgin olive oil and sprinkle in Parmesan cheese. Whisk once more until the dressing reaches a smooth and velvety consistency. Taste and adjust the seasoning as needed before refrigerating for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to marry and intensify. While our dressing chills in the refrigerator, we turn our attention to the other components of our Grilled Caesar Salad. In a skillet over medium heat, we sizzle bacon slices until they achieve crispy perfection, infusing the salad with smoky, savory goodness. Next, we prepare the romaine lettuce, cutting each head in half lengthwise and brushing both sides with extra virgin olive oil. With the grill preheated to medium-high heat, we place the romaine halves on the grates, allowing them to char slightly and develop a tantalizing smoky flavor. Finally, it’s time to assemble our masterpiece. We place the grilled romaine lettuce halves on a serving platter and generously drizzle them with our homemade Caesar dressing. A sprinkling crispy bacon bits and extra grated Parmesan cheese over the top adds the perfect finishing touch, providing a satisfying crunch and burst of flavor in every bite. Prep time: 30mins
Cook time: 15mins
Serves or Makes: 4

Recipe Card

ingredients

For the Grilled Cesar Salad

  • 2 romaine lettuce hearts
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 4 slices of bacon
  • for garnish grated Parmesan cheese
  • to taste salt and ground black pepper

ingredients

For the Cesar Dressing

  • 4 fillets of minced anchovy
  • 2 cloves of minced garlic
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 teaspoon prepared horseradish
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per

Method

  • Step 1

    Prepare Cesar Salad Dressing: In a mixing bowl, combine the minced anchovy fillets, minced garlic, Dijon mustard, freshly squeezed l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, mayonnaise, prepared horseradish, and ground black pepper. Mix until well combined.

  • Step 2

    Add in Oil and Cheese: Slowly whisk in the extra virgin olive oil and the Parmesan cheese. Whisk the ingredients together until they are well combined and the dressing is smooth and creamy. Taste the dressing and adjust the seasoning if necessary, adding more salt, pepper, or lemon juice to suit your preferences.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ld, while you prepare the rest of the salad.

  • Step 3

    Cook the Bacon: In a sk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on slices until they are crispy, about 5-7 minutes. Once cooked, remove them from the skillet and let them cool. Chop or crumble them into small bits.

  • Step 4

    Prepare the Romaine Lettuce: Cut each heart of romaine lettuce in half lengthwise, leaving the core intact to hold the leaves together. Brush both sides of the romaine lettuce halves with extra virgin olive oil, ensuring they are evenly coated.

  • Step 5

    Grill the Romaine Lettuce: Pre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Place the prepared romaine lettuce halves on the grill, cut side down. Grill for about 2-3 minutes, or until grill marks appear and the lettuce begins to wilt slightly. Turn over and grill the other side for 1-2 minutes. Remove from the grill and set aside.

  • Step 6

    Assemble the Salad: Place the grilled romaine lettuce halves on a serving platter. Drizzle the Caesar dressing generously over the grilled romaine lettuce halves. Sprinkle the bacon bits and extra grated Parmesan cheese over the top of the lettuce. Enjoy your Grilled Caesar Salad with Homemade Caesar Dressing!
